FYI, "The big crunch" is not a gigantic black hole sucking in the universe.
"The big crunch" occurs when the sum of the mass of the universe is greater than the expansion of the universe and the universe collapses on itself.

Imagine a ball being thrown at the sky, the ball must fall down. Scientists used to believe that the expansion of the universe would behave the same way. The mass of the universe would attract the expansion, and eventually there would be a collapse. This has been proven to be false in the 70s (The expansion is actually accelerating exponentially, not slowing down) and there is no big crunch ever coming.
